Tip #111: Locate heating and cooling equipment centrally in the home

The positioning of your heating and cooling equipment can make a big difference in both comfort and in the energy efficiency. Centrally located equipment will have less work to do to move the heated or cooled air throughout the house. Centrally located equipment also provides heated or cooled air more evenly throughout the house. Your level of comfort will increase by mitigating the possibility of having cooler or warmer rooms while you save money on your heating and cooling cost throughout the year. Whether the heating and cooling equipment is placed in a basement or crawl space, or in an attic, or even outside your home, you can plan and design for central positioning. Central placement will also save money on installation by keeping all ducts to the shortest possible lengths. This attention to detail in planning and design will provide years of comfort and savings.
